Naturally Learning Redruth is set in a beautiful Grade II listed building.

The former Redruth library, now known as The Ladder, was founded by Cornish philanthropist John Passmore Edwards.

Passmore encouraged people to access educational opportunities for growth by funding public libraries. He was particularly interested to see how Cornwall would progress due to the creative people living in the county - such as artists, writers, teachers, and children.
